Get an entry's private key
Get-RDMEntryPrivateKey [-InputObject] <PSConnection> [[-ExportPath] <string>] [-NoClobber]
[-VaultMode <VaultMode>] [-ForcePromptAnswer <DialogResult[]>] [<CommonParameters>]
Get-RDMEntryPrivateKey [-ID] <guid> [[-ExportPath] <string>] [-NoClobber] [-VaultMode <VaultMode>]
[-ForcePromptAnswer <DialogResult[]>] [<CommonParameters>]
Get-RDMEntryPrivateKey [[-ExportPath] <string>] -InputObject <PSConnection> [-NoClobber]
[-VaultMode <VaultMode>] [-ForcePromptAnswer <DialogResult[]>] [<CommonParameters>]
Get an entry's private key. Two types of private key are supported: Embedded data and File (local). The user must also have the right to edit the entry. Additionaly, the 'ExportPath' parameter allows for the key to be saved into a file. Only a vault owner or administrator can export the key.")]
Get-RDMEntry -Name 'My Private Key Cred' | Get-RDMEntryPrivateKey -ExportPath 'myfile.key' | Out-Null
Save the private key from the entry named 'My Private Key Cred' into a file named 'myfile.key'.

Switch to use with caution. It will automatically answer prompt asking yes/no, yes/no/cancel, or ok/cancel questions. In case of multiple prompts, multiple values can be passed to this parameter. Here are the accepted values:
Yes: Accept the prompt. Cover the OK and Automatic value.
No: Refuse the yes/no/cancel prompt. Cancel is the fallback option if there is not an option No.
Cancel: Cancel the yes/no/cancel prompt. No is the fallback option if there is not an option Cancel.

NoClobber prevents an existing file from being overwritten and displays a message that the file already exists. By default, if a file exists in the specified path, it is overwritten.

Vault where the command will be applied. Three choices are offered:
Default: Current vault that has been set.
User: Vault specific to the current user.
Global: Global vault of the data source.
